On , OSHA opened a planned health inspection of CARBOLINE COMPANY in 4910 LEOPARD STREET, CORPUS CHRISTI, TX 78408 (NAICS 424950). OSHA activity number 346761109.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.157(e)(3): Portable fire extinguishers were not subjected to an annual maintenance check: On or about June 9, 2023, and at times prior thereto, portable extinguishers, were not annually inspected to ensure fire extinguishers operated effectively and safely.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.157(g)(1): An educational program was not provided for all employees to familiarize them with the general principles of fire extinguisher use and the hazards involved with incipient stage fire fighting: On or about June 9, 2023, and times prior thereto, the employer did not ensure that employees who were expected to use portable extinguishers were trained on fire extinguisher use and the hazards involved with incipient stage fire fighting.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.22(a)(1): The employer did not ensure that all places of employment, passageways, storerooms, service rooms, and walking-working surfaces are kept in a clean, orderly, and sanitary conditions: On or about June 9, 2023, and at times prior thereto, employees that warehoused, sold and repackaged painting products drove and serviced lead acid battery forklifts that contained lead and cadmium. Work surfaces were not regularly cleaned to prevent accumulation of lead and cadmium.
